// SPDX-License-Identifier: CC0-1.0
//! Provides [`NumberOfBlocks`] and [`NumberOf512Seconds`] types used by the `rust-bitcoin` `relative::LockTime` type.
use core::fmt;
#[cfg(feature = "arbitrary")]
use arbitrary::{Arbitrary, Unstructured};
#[cfg(feature = "serde")]
use serde::{Deserialize, Serialize};
#[deprecated(since = "TBD", note = "use `NumberOfBlocks` instead")]
#[doc(hidden)]
pub type Height = NumberOfBlocks;
/// A relative lock time lock-by-blockheight value.
#[derive(Debug, Default, Clone, Copy, PartialEq, Eq, PartialOrd, Ord, Hash)]
#[cfg_attr(feature = "serde", derive(Serialize, Deserialize))]
pub struct NumberOfBlocks(u16);
impl NumberOfBlocks {
/// Relative block height 0, can be included in any block.
pub const ZERO: Self = Self(0);
/// The minimum relative block height (0), can be included in any block.
pub const MIN: Self = Self::ZERO;
/// The maximum relative block height.
pub const MAX: Self = Self(u16::MAX);
/// Constructs a new [`NumberOfBlocks`] using a count of blocks.
#[inline]
pub const fn from_height(blocks: u16) -> Self { Self(blocks) }
/// Express the [`Height`] as a count of blocks.
#[inline]
#[must_use]
pub const fn to_height(self) -> u16 { self.0 }
/// Returns the inner `u16` value.
#[inline]
#[must_use]
#[deprecated(since = "TBD", note = "use `to_height` instead")]
#[doc(hidden)]
pub const fn value(self) -> u16 { self.0 }
/// Returns the `u32` value used to encode this locktime in an nSequence field or
/// argument to `OP_CHECKSEQUENCEVERIFY`.
#[deprecated(
since = "TBD",
note = "use `LockTime::from` followed by `to_consensus_u32` instead"
)]
pub const fn to_consensus_u32(self) -> u32 {
self.0 as u32 // cast safety: u32 is wider than u16 on all architectures
}
/// Determines whether a relativeheight locktime has matured, taking into account
/// both the chain tip and the height at which the UTXO was confirmed.
///
/// If you have two height intervals `x` and `y`, and want to know whether `x`
/// is satisfied by `y`, use `x >= y`.
///
/// # Parameters
/// - `self` the relative blockheight delay (`h`) required after confirmation.
/// - `chain_tip` the height of the current chain tip
/// - `utxo_mined_at` the height of the UTXOs confirmation block
///
/// # Returns
/// - `true` if a UTXO locked by `self` can be spent in a block after `chain_tip`.
/// - `false` if the UTXO is still locked at `chain_tip`.
pub fn is_satisfied_by(
self,
chain_tip: crate::BlockHeight,
utxo_mined_at: crate::BlockHeight,
) -> bool {
chain_tip
.checked_sub(utxo_mined_at)
.and_then(|diff: crate::BlockHeightInterval| diff.try_into().ok())
.map_or(false, |diff: Self| diff >= self)
}
}
impl From<u16> for NumberOfBlocks {
#[inline]
fn from(value: u16) -> Self { NumberOfBlocks(value) }
}
crate::impl_parse_str_from_int_infallible!(NumberOfBlocks, u16, from);
impl fmt::Display for NumberOfBlocks {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ter) -> fmt::Result { fmt::Display::fmt(&self.0, f) }
}
#[deprecated(since = "TBD", note = "use `NumberOf512Seconds` instead")]
#[doc(hidden)]
pub type Time = NumberOf512Seconds;
/// A relative lock time lock-by-blocktime value.
///
/// For BIP 68 relative lock-by-blocktime locks, time is measured in 512 second intervals.
#[derive(Debug, Default, Clone, Copy, PartialEq, Eq, PartialOrd, Ord, Hash)]
#[cfg_attr(feature = "serde", derive(Serialize, Deserialize))]
pub struct NumberOf512Seconds(u16);
impl NumberOf512Seconds {
/// Relative block time 0, can be included in any block.
pub const ZERO: Self = NumberOf512Seconds(0);
/// The minimum relative block time (0), can be included in any block.
pub const MIN: Self = NumberOf512Seconds::ZERO;
/// The maximum relative block time (33,554,432 seconds or approx 388 days).
pub const MAX: Self = NumberOf512Seconds(u16::MAX);
/// Constructs a new [`NumberOf512Seconds`] using time intervals where each interval is equivalent to 512 seconds.
///
/// Encoding finer granularity of time for relative lock-times is not supported in Bitcoin.
#[inline]
pub const fn from_512_second_intervals(intervals: u16) -> Self { NumberOf512Seconds(intervals) }
/// Express the [`NumberOf512Seconds`] as an integer number of 512-second intervals.
#[inline]
#[must_use]
pub const fn to_512_second_intervals(self) -> u16 { self.0 }
/// Constructs a new [`NumberOf512Seconds`] from seconds, converting the seconds into 512 second interval with
/// truncating division.
///
/// # Errors
///
/// Will return an error if the input cannot be encoded in 16 bits.
#[inline]
#[rustfmt::skip] // moves comments to unrelated code
pub const fn from_seconds_floor(seconds: u32) -> Result<Self, TimeOverflowError> {
let interval = seconds / 512;
if interval <= u16::MAX as u32 { // infallible cast, needed by const code
Ok(NumberOf512Seconds::from_512_second_intervals(interval as u16)) // Cast checked above, needed by const code.
} else {
Err(TimeOverflowError { seconds })
}
}
/// Constructs a new [`NumberOf512Seconds`] from seconds, converting the seconds into 512 second intervals with
/// ceiling division.
///
/// # Errors
///
/// Will return an error if the input cannot be encoded in 16 bits.
#[inline]
#[rustfmt::skip] // moves comments to unrelated code
pub const fn from_seconds_ceil(seconds: u32) -> Result<Self, TimeOverflowError> {
if seconds <= u16::MAX as u32 * 512 {
let interval = (seconds + 511) / 512;
Ok(NumberOf512Seconds::from_512_second_intervals(interval as u16)) // Cast checked above, needed by const code.
} else {
Err(TimeOverflowError { seconds })
}
}
/// Represents the [`NumberOf512Seconds`] as an integer number of seconds.
#[inline]
pub const fn to_seconds(self) -> u32 {
self.0 as u32 * 512 // u16->u32 cast ok, const context
}
/// Returns the inner `u16` value.
#[inline]
#[must_use]
#[deprecated(since = "TBD", note = "use `to_512_second_intervals` instead")]
#[doc(hidden)]
pub const fn value(self) -> u16 { self.0 }
/// Returns the `u32` value used to encode this locktime in an nSequence field or
/// argument to `OP_CHECKSEQUENCEVERIFY`.
#[deprecated(
since = "TBD",
note = "use `LockTime::from` followed by `to_consensus_u32` instead"
)]
pub const fn to_consensus_u32(self) -> u32 {
(1u32 << 22) | self.0 as u32 // cast safety: u32 is wider than u16 on all architectures
}
/// Determines whether a relativetime lock has matured, taking into account both
/// the UTXOs Median Time Past at confirmation and the required delay.
///
/// If you have two MTP intervals `x` and `y`, and want to know whether `x`
/// is satisfied by `y`, use `x >= y`.
///
/// # Parameters
/// - `self` the relative time delay (`t`) in 512second intervals.
/// - `chain_tip` the MTP of the current chain tip
/// - `utxo_mined_at` the MTP of the UTXOs confirmation block
///
/// # Returns
/// - `true` if the relativetime lock has expired by the tips MTP
/// - `false` if the lock has not yet expired by the tips MTP
pub fn is_satisfied_by(
self,
chain_tip: crate::BlockMtp,
utxo_mined_at: crate::BlockMtp,
) -> bool {
chain_tip
.checked_sub(utxo_mined_at)
.and_then(|diff: crate::BlockMtpInterval| diff.to_relative_mtp_interval_floor().ok())
.map_or(false, |diff: Self| diff >= self)
}
}
crate::impl_parse_str_from_int_infallible!(NumberOf512Seconds, u16, from_512_second_intervals);
impl fmt::Display for NumberOf512Seconds {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ter) -> fmt::Result { fmt::Display::fmt(&self.0, f) }
}
/// Error returned when the input time in seconds was too large to be encoded to a 16 bit 512 second interval.
#[der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q, Eq)]
pub struct TimeOverflowError {
/// Time interval value in seconds that overflowed.
// Private because we maintain an invariant that the `seconds` value does actually overflow.
pub(crate) seconds: u32,
}
impl TimeOverflowError {
/// Constructs a new `TimeOverflowError` using `seconds`.
///
/// # Panics
///
/// If `seconds` would not actually overflow a `u16`.
pub fn new(seconds: u32) -> Self {
assert!(u16::try_from((seconds + 511) / 512).is_err());
Self { seconds }
}
}
impl fmt::Display for TimeOverflowError {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ter) -> fmt::Result {
write!(
f,
"{} seconds is too large to be encoded to a 16 bit 512 second interval",
self.seconds
)
}
}
#[cfg(feature = "std")]
impl std::error::Error for TimeOverflowError {}
